Arscott is a small hamlet in Shropshire, England. It is near to Plealey, Shorthill and Annscroft and within the civil parish of Pontesbury.[1]

The hamlet is spread out along Pound Lane and has a number of Victorian cottages associated with the local farms or coal mines[2] working as early as 1838, the last closing in 1919.[3]

Nearby is the hamlet of Arscott Villa, which adjoins Annscroft.

There is an 18-hole golf course at Arscott, which opened in 1992 and is the home of the Arscott Golf Club.[4]
